qXMLNet x2.0.

for generationQ v2.0

Copyright (c) Quantel Ltd 2002-2004

1. Installation

1.1. Copy qXMLNet folder to any PC connected to LAN.


1.2. Edit qXMLNet.reg for default parameters
"ServerName" - most commonly used iQ Computer Name.
XMLGet/"Format" - default format.
XMLPut/"FrameRate" - default frame rate.
XMLPut/"1001" - default frame rate modifier. eg FrameRate of 30 with 1001 on,
means 29.97.
XMLPut/"Scan" - default scan: "Interlace" or "Progressive".
All default parameters can be overridden in a command line.
1.3. Register qXMLNet.reg.
1.4. Open the registry and edit XMLGet/"Folder" - folder where clips will be
exported to.
1.5. If qXMLNet is on a remote non-iQ machine then msxml3sp2Setup.exe must be
installed.

2. XMLDir.exe

2.1. XMLDir retrieves contents of a clip bin from any iQ connected to LAN.

2.2. Parameters
XMLDir.exe <Mask>
-so <Source> : source iQ

Required parameter is <Mask>.

2.3. Examples
XMLDir.exe * - display all clips.
XMLDir.exe a* - display clips that start with 'a'.
XMLDir.exe *topgear* - display clips containing 'topgear'.
XMLDir.exe * -so iQcrateA - display all clips from iQcrateA.

3. XMLGet.exe

3.1. XMLGet send instructions to a remote iQ to export a clip.

3.2. Parameters
XMLGet <ClipName>
-so <Source> : source iQ
-fd <Folder> : destination folder
-fn <FileName> : destination file name
-ts <Timecode> : export start time code hh:mm:ss:ff
-tl <Timecode> : export length time code hh:mm:ss:ff
-fo <Format> : destination format
-dx <Dest X> : destination X size (Y size is modified to maintain aspect
ratio)
-tf : time code based file names (required for XMLPut retouch)

All parameters are optional except <ClipName>.


3.3. Examples
XMLGet.exe "Ten O'clock News"
XMLGet.exe "Ten O'clock News" -fd \\PicServer\clips\TenO'clockNews -fo dpx
XMLGet.exe "Ten O'clock News" -fd \\WebServer\clips\TenO'clockNews -fo avi -dx
360

4. XMLPut.exe

4.1. XMLPut sends instructions to a remote iQ to import a clip.

4.2. Parameters
XMLPut <SourceDir>
-de <Destination> : destination iQ
-fn <Filename> : mask for file name
-ti <Title> : clip title
-pr <Project> : clip project (separate nested folders with '\')
-ow <Owner> : clip owner
-ca <Category> : clip category
-ta <Tapename> : tape name
-tc <Timecode> : hh:mm:ss:ff or hh:mm:ss.ff for drop frame
-kf <KeycodeFmt> : keycode format number (see list below)
-sc <Scan> : scan type (Interlace or Progressive)
-fr <Framerate> : 23.98, 24, 25, 29.97, 30, 59.94 or 60
-bl <Black> : black level
-wh <White> : white level
-lin : force data to be flagged as linear
-log : force data to be flagged as logarithmic
-print : force data to be flagged as print density
-ax <AspectX> : pixel aspect X
-ay <AspectY> : pixel aspect Y
-ex <OrigTitle> : extends clip with new frames
-re <OrigTitle> : retouches clip with new frames
-ch <Channels> : audio channels track patching

All parameters are optional except <SourceDir>.

-kf usage:
1. 16mm 20fr per ft
2. 16mm 40fr per ft
3. 35mm 3perf (perf1)
4. 35mm 3perf (perf2)
5. 35mm 3perf (perf3)
6. 35mm 4perf
7. 35mm 8perf
8. 65mm 5perf (60fps)
9. 65/70mm (80) 5perf
10. 65/70mm (80) 8perf
11. 65/70mm (80) 10perf
12. 65/70mm (120) 5perf
13. 65/70mm (120) 8perf
14. 65/70mm (120) 10perf
15. 65/70mm (120) 15perf

-fn usage:
When not used, the complete folder contents will be transferred to the target
iQ.
When used, only the files with this mask will be transferred.
-ex usage:
Use '-ex none' to create an extensible clip.
To create extensible clip 'fred', use XMLPut.exe SourceDir -ti fred -ex none
To extend extensible clip 'fred', use XMLPut.exe SourceDir -ex fred

-re usage:
The clip to be retouched is cloned once before it is retouched for the first
time.
Retouched frames are matched to the retouch clip using destination timecode
from the filename.
To retouch clip 'fred' using the frames in SourceDir, use XMLPut.exe SourceDir
-re fred

4.3. Examples
XMLPut.exe \\PicServer\clips\TopGear
XMLPut.exe \\PicServer\clips\TopGear -ti "Top Gear 51"
XMLPut.exe \\PicServer\clips\TopGear -ti "Top Gear 51" -fn top
